PERIODS OF DEVELOPMENT
- 0-6 infancy: age of transformation
- 0-3 child absorbs envrionment
- home environment and family most important
- needs: love, security, routine, order, movement,
exploration, stimulation
- 3-6 age of activity, experience
- child absorbs social group
- needs: school environment, purposive activity,
positive social experience, order contribution to
environment and group
- 6-12 childhood: age of abstraction
- stability, robustness
- needs: peer group, organized social groups (ie. Scouts),
adult sounding board for right/wrong/injustice, cosmic
education
- 12-15 adolescence: age of adjustment
- sensitivity, irregular growth, caught in-between
- needs: encouragement, religious study, humanities,
physical activity to gain coordination
- 15-18 maturity: age of developing stability
- experiences and influences last, abstract love for
others, responsibility
- needs: job/money, parents as guides, friends

THE ABSORBENT MIND
- 0-6 child ABSORBS ALL
- Child's mind acts like a sponge, integrating everything
accurately, nonjudgementally, uncritically, effortlessly.
- 0-3 absorbent mind functions unconsciously. 3-6 function
consciously. Child takes in the environment through the
senses, movement and exploration, and ADAPTS.
SENSITIVE PERIODS
Transitory periods during which the child acquires a certain
characteristic. Child's attention is drawn irresistably to
certain elements. Once the characteristic is acquired the
sensitivity disappears.
- LANGUAGE: 3 months to 1 1/2 years. Needs:
clear articulation, proper use of language, creative use
of language, show/teach love of reading/communication.
- ORDER: 1 - 3 years. Needs: routine at
home (stay flexible!), order in home environment.
- SENSORY REFINEMENT: 0 - 5 years. Senses
are gateways to perception. Child learns classification
thru matching, grading, categorization. Needs: sensorial
exploration. Play with color, shpae, texture, sound, taste,
smell. Give language after experience.
- SMALL THINGS: 2nd year of life. Child
fills in his BIG PICTURE with the details. Needs: Explore
the tiny things in the world. The bugs in the grass, designs
on a tree trunk, patterns in a leaf, blossoms. Small details
in a picture, shades in color, design in fabrics, little
toys and objects around the house, go on a tiny treasure
hunt on a shelf.
- SOCIAL DEVELOPMENT: 2 1/2 - 5 years.
Child explores, absorbs the group and social behavior. Needs:
modeled acceptable social behavior at home and in a positive
school setting. Natural consequences for improper behavior,
ie. removal from group nucleus if behavior is unacceptable.
Calm, graceful, pleasant care.
